Operation Dixie
A post-World War II campaign launched by the Congress of Industrial Organizations (CIO) aimed at unionizing Southern textile workers and promoting racial integration in the industrial sector.
Anti-Labor Conservatives
Individuals or groups holding conservative ideologies that typically oppose labor movements, union activities, and policies aimed at improving conditions for workers.
GIs
Term commonly used to refer to soldiers of the United States Army and airmen of the United States Army Air Forces, especially those who served during World War II.
World War II
A global conflict that lasted from 1939 to 1945, involving most of the world's nations and marked by significant battles, genocide, nuclear bombings, and the Holocaust.
